2008 Lamborghini Murcielago | 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ander | |
Make | Lamborghini | Mitsubishi |
Model | Murcielago | Outlander |
Year Released | 2008 | 2006 |
Body Type | Convertible | SUV |
Engine Position | Middle | Front |
Engine Size | 6496 cc | 2376 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 12 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 5 valves |
Horse Power | 631 HP | 160 HP |
Engine RPM | 8000 RPM | 5750 RPM |
Torque | 660 Nm | 220 Nm |
Torque RPM | 6000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 88.1 mm | 87.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 89.9 mm | 100 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 | 9.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| 4WD |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1690 kg | 1785 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4620 mm | 4550 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2060 mm | 1790 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1140 mm | 1690 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2670 mm | 2630 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 21.3 L/100km | 10.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 100 L | 59 L |
